ABOUT THE ARTIST

Fran Poch
(Chile)
Fran Poch is a Chilean music selector based in Berlin, where she has been living for almost seven years. Her work moves between art, design, and music. Sound and painting are the two things that have always attracted her the most.
Her sets are born out of curiosity. She is constantly searching for sounds that evoke feelings, stories, images. It's about finding that unknown track that opens up a new little world.
At first, her search focused mainly on organic and rhythmic sounds: Brazilian music, soul, funk, disco. After moving to Berlin, she came across the local and niche “cosmic scene” (Camp Cosmic, Sameheads, Arkaoda, O Tannenbaum) and gradually drifted into more experimental territories. Music created with sounds she hadn't heard much before, sounds coming from synthesizers. A new world opened up to her, and since then, she hasn't stopped searching for those songs that make her move and get excited.
That’s why in her sets you can hear music going in many directions. Mainly leftfield and early electronics, downtempo, avant-garde, Neue Deutsche Welle (German new wave), krautrock, k-jazz, synth pop, post-punk, and bedroom recordings. Probably more marked by 80s sounds, but also integrating many contemporary artists who are making more experimental music.
